Correa ‘Lime Chimes’ is a compact, low-growing form, prized for its neat habit and delicate, lime-green bell-shaped flowers that bloom from autumn to early spring. Typically growing to around 30–50 cm high and up to 1 meter wide, this cultivar provides a soft, mounding effect perfect for foreground planting, containers, or native rockeries. The small, oval, grey-green leaves add fine texture and contrast year-round.

Well-suited to dry shade, Lime Chimes is highly adaptable and thrives in a range of garden styles, from native plantings to formal borders. It’s also a valuable habitat plant, attracting small birds such as honeyeaters during its flowering season.

Growing Conditions:

  • Position: Prefers part shade to full sun; ideal for dry shade under trees
  • Soil: Well-drained soils; tolerates sandy, loamy, or light clay
  • Watering: Drought-tolerant once established; occasional deep watering recommended during extended dry periods
  • Frost tolerance: Moderate
  • Maintenance: Low; light pruning after flowering helps maintain shape
  • Fertiliser: Use a low-phosphorus native fertiliser annually in spring
